What is Ronaldinho's Biography?

Ronaldinho's biography is a testament to his remarkable journey from a young boy in Brazil to a global football superstar. His life story serves as an inspiration for aspiring athletes worldwide. Here’s a brief overview of his biography:

DetailInformation
Full NameRonaldo de Assis Moreira
Date of BirthMarch 21, 1980
Place of BirthPorto Alegre, Brazil
Height1.81 m (5 ft 11 in)
PositionAttacking Midfielder / Forward
Clubs Played ForGrêmio, Paris Saint-Germain, FC Barcelona, AC Milan, Atlético Mineiro, Querétaro, and more
International CareerBrazil National Team (2002 FIFA World Cup Champion)
Individual AwardsFIFA World Player of the Year (2004, 2005), Ballon d'Or (2005)

What Were Ronaldinho's Major Career Milestones?

Ronaldinho's career is marked by numerous milestones that showcase his extraordinary talent and impact on the sport. Here are some of the key highlights:

  • Grêmio: Ronaldinho began his professional career with Grêmio, where he won the Copa do Brasil in 1997 and the Copa Sul-Americana in 1999.
  • Paris Saint-Germain: In 2001, he joined PSG, where he won the Ligue 1 title and was named the Ligue 1 Player of the Year in 2003.
  • FC Barcelona: Ronaldinho's move to Barcelona in 2003 proved to be a turning point in his career. He won two La Liga titles and the UEFA Champions League in 2006, and he was awarded the FIFA World Player of the Year in 2004 and 2005.
  • AC Milan: In 2008, he signed with AC Milan, adding another prestigious club to his impressive resume. He won the Serie A title in 2011.
  • International Success: Ronaldinho played a crucial role in Brazil's 2002 FIFA World Cup victory, contributing to the team's success with his exceptional skills and creativity.
